Prithvi Shaw visits Ujjain with fiancée before IPL, participates in Bhasma Aarti

Indian cricketer Prithvi Shaw visited Ujjain with his fiancée, Aakriti Agarwal, to participate in the revered Bhasma Aarti at the Mahakaleshwar Temple ahead of the 2026 IPL season.

Ahead of the 2026 Indian Premier League (IPL) season, Indian cricketer Prithvi Shaw made a visit to Ujjain, a city known for its religious significance, accompanied by his fiancée Aakriti Agarwal. They attended the famous Bhasma Aarti at the Mahakaleshwar Temple, where Shaw shared that the experience was special and highlighted the positivity he felt during the visit. This Aarti is considered extremely sacred and draws thousands of devotees from across the country and abroad every morning.

Shaw expressed his gratitude and excitement regarding the experience, marking it as his first visit to the Bhasma Aarti, a ritual he had heard much about. He noted the wonderful atmosphere and divine feeling he experienced while worshipping at the temple. The temple of Mahakal, along with its early morning rituals, holds significant relevance to many devotees, adding a spiritual dimension to Shaw's sports career, especially as he prepares for the upcoming cricket season.

In addition to their temple visit, Shaw recently announced his engagement to long-time girlfriend Aakriti Agarwal, sharing pictures on social media that delighted his fans. His caption reflected on the joys of both his sporting life and personal milestones, suggesting that he aims to achieve success both on and off the cricket field. This engagement news adds another layer of excitement and positivity as Shaw continues his journey in cricket and life.
